What are some strategies for effective delegation?

Assigning tasks based on individual strengths and skills is a crucial strategy for effective delegation. This approach ensures that each team member is positioned to succeed by leveraging their unique talents and expertise. When tasks are matched to an individual’s capabilities, it not only enhances the overall productivity of the team but also boosts morale, as team members feel valued for their contributions. Effective delegation fosters an environment where each person is encouraged to take ownership of their work, leading to higher quality outcomes and personal development.

Tasks can often be complex or varied, so using a blanket approach like delegating all tasks equally or limiting delegation to senior staff doesn't take full advantage of the diverse skills and talents within the team. Similarly, restricting the tasks to one's own skillset limits the potential for team growth and innovation. By strategically assigning tasks, leaders can ensure efficient use of resources and foster a collaborative spirit within the team.
